Backport r1164722: Fix shift modifier key not working when pressed on remote keyboard.

Patch by Dariusz Mikulski.

CCBUG:182073

svn path=/branches/KDE/4.5/kdenetwork/krfb/; revision=1164724
This commit is contained in:
George Goldberg
2010-08-17 14:42:24 +00:00
parent 222dc7d6c6
commit ba374412c8

View File

@@ -84,11 +84,11 @@ void KeyboardEvent::tweakModifiers(signed char mod, bool down)
if(isShift && mod != 1) {
if(ModifierState & LEFTSHIFT) {
XTestFakeKeyEvent(dpy, leftShiftCode,
!down, CurrentTime);
down, CurrentTime);
}
if(ModifierState & RIGHTSHIFT) {
XTestFakeKeyEvent(dpy, rightShiftCode,
!down, CurrentTime);
down, CurrentTime);
}
}